11/04/2022 (Agence Europe) – Some 150 companies sent a joint letter to the European Commission on Monday 11 April asking it to prepare a European strategy on geothermal energy and sustainable raw material extraction by 2023. “The purpose of the strategy is to unlock geothermal energy’s potential as a major renewable energy source across the internal market and neighbouring countries”, the letter says. For the signatory organisations, this strategy should notably aim at identifying the obstacles to the development of geothermal energy, proposing measures to accelerate its deployment (especially with regard to heating and cooling infrastructures), crowding-in financing, de-risking of private investments, while maintaining high environmental standards.
